QuickFox Supply Chain Attack Delivers FDMTP Backdoor via Trojanized Windows Installer

A sophisticated supply chain attack has compromised thousands of Windows systems worldwide, leveraging a Trojanized version of the popular Fiddler web debugging tool to inject a backdoor malware known as FDMTP. The QuickFox attack highlights the vulnerability of software development and distribution chains, underscoring the need for enhanced security measures in these critical infrastructure components.

At its core, the QuickFox supply chain attack revolves around the exploitation of a compromised version of the popular Windows Installer package, used by millions to install various applications on their systems. The attackers manipulated this installer to include a Trojanized component of Fiddler, a legitimate web debugging tool widely employed for testing and troubleshooting purposes. When installed, the corrupted Fiddler component embedded the FDMTP backdoor malware onto affected machines. This allowed unauthorized actors to access compromised systems, essentially creating an open door for further malicious activity.

The breadth of the attack’s impact is significant. According to researchers who uncovered the incident, thousands of Windows users have been affected by this supply chain assault. Moreover, the potential for future exploitation is considerable, given that these compromised machines now carry an active backdoor. This not only compromises individual privacy but also poses a collective risk to the security posture of any organization whose employees use these systems.
